OET-LV PSA Chapter 40

OETPSA 40 ©

This is still a very early look into the unfinished text of the Open English Translation of the Bible. Please double-check the text in advance before using in public.

40To_choirmaster of_Dāvid a_song.
2[fn] patiently_(wait) I_waited_for YHWH and_he_stretched_out to_me and_he/it_listened for_help_of_my_cry.
3[fn] and_he_brought_me_up from_a_pit_of roaring from_the_mud_of the_mire and_he_set on a_rock feet_of_my he_established steps_of_my.
4[fn] and_he/it_gave in_my_of_mouth a_song new praise to_our_of_god they_will_see many_people and_they_will_fear and_they_will_trust in_YHWH.
5[fn] how_blessed is_the_man who he_has_made YHWH of_confidence_of_his_object and_not he_has_turned to proud_people and_those_who_fall_away_of falsehood.
6[fn] many you_have_made you Oh_YHWH god_of_my your(pl)_of_wonders and_your(pl)_of_plans to_us there_is_not to_compare to_you I_will_declare and_I_will_speak they_are_too_numerous for_recounting.
7[fn] sacrifice and_offering not you_desired ears you_dug to/for_me burnt_offering and_sin_offering not you_asked_for.
8[fn] then I_said here I_have_come in_the_scroll_of the_book it_is_written on_me.
9[fn] to_do will_of_your my_god_of_Oh I_desire and_your_of_law[fn] in_the_middle my_inward_parts_of_of.
10[fn] I_have_borne_news righteousness in_the_assembly great here lips_of_my not I_restrain Oh_YHWH you you_know.
11[fn] righteousness_of_your not I_have_concealed in_the_middle my_heart_of_of faithfulness_of_your and_your_of_salvation I_have_spoken not I_have_hidden loyalty_of_your_covenant and_your_of_faithfulness to_the_assembly great.
12[fn] you Oh_YHWH not you_will_withhold compassion(s)_of_your from_me loyalty_of_your_covenant and_your_of_faithfulness continually they_preserve_me.
13[fn] if/because they_have_encompassed (on)_me troubles until there_was_not number they_have_overtaken_me iniquities_of_my and_not I_am_able to_see they_are_numerous more_than_the_hairs_of my_head and_my_of_heart it_has_abandoned_me.
14[fn] be_pleased Oh_YHWH to_deliver_me Oh_YHWH to_my_of_help make_haste.
15[fn] may_they_be_ashamed and_may_they_be_abashed altogether life_of_(of)_my those_who_seek_of to_snatch_it_away may_they_be_turned_back backwards and_may_they_be_humiliated the_people_desirous_of my_harm_of_of.
16[fn] may_they_be_appalled on the_consequence_of their_shame_of_of those_who_say to_me aha[fn] aha.
17[fn] may_they_exult and_may_they_rejoice in_you all_of those_of_who_seek_you may_they_say continually may_he_be_great YHWH those_who_love_of salvation_of_(of)_your.
18[fn] and_I am_poor and_needy my_master may_he_think to_me help_of_are_my and_my_of_deliverer you my_god_of_Oh do_not delay.
